All-Pro RB Jonathan Taylor has Requested to be Traded
The trend this offseason has been about the unhappy running backs in the NFL this year, and now, we are seeing another RB joining the pack.
Colts star RB Jonathan Taylor has requested to be traded, following a conversation he had with the team owner, Jim Irsay.
According to NFL Insider Ian Rapoport, Taylor had a discussion with Irsay about a possible contract extension and to be paid at a much higher price, but Irsay said no.
Taylor then requested to be traded, but again, Irsay said no. Irsay said this to The Athletic's James Boyd:

"If I die tonight and Jonathan Taylor is out of the league, no one's gonna miss us. The league goes on. We know that. The National Football (League) rolls on. It doesn't matter who comes and who goes, and it's a privilege to be a part of it"
- Irsay said
Taylor is one of the best RBs in the NFL, especially in his second year, in 2021. That year, he was a Pro Bowler, a First-Team All-Pro, and the NFL rushing yards leader. When Taylor is healthy, he is arguably the best RB in the NFL.
So, it looks like Irsay refuses to pay him or trade him, which means Taylor may be sitting out this year.
